According to the Internal Revenue Service, If an exempt organization regularly carries on a trade or business not substantially related to its exempt purpose, except that it provides funds to carry out that purpose, the organization is subject to tax on its income from that unrelated trade or business. For purposes of determining eligibility for the welfare exemption, it is the use of the parsonage and related facilities by the organization owning the property that is to be considered, not the occupants use. The Minnesota appeals court noted that there were two issues: " (1) whether the property qualifies for exemption on the basis that the rent proceeds are utilized for church purposes; and (2) whether the temporary rental of a parsonage pending arrival of a new pastor destroys the tax exemption."
